The Advocate Group in Newcastle on Clun is seeking a Field Sales Executive to manage your own territory and drive sales growth for a leading FMCG brand. In this role, you will be responsible for increasing brand visibility and delivering strong in-store execution across independent retail accounts.
The ideal candidate will have prior experience in FMCG or field sales, be energetic and highly motivated, and possess excellent communication skills. Join a dynamic team and make a significant impact in the marketplace.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Advocate Group
✨Know Your FMCG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of the FMCG sector. Understand the latest trends, key players, and what makes a brand successful in this space. This will show that you're not just interested in the role but are genuinely passionate about the industry.
✨Show Off Your Sales Skills
Prepare to discuss specific examples from your past experiences where you've driven sales growth or improved brand visibility.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and make them impactful.
✨Demonstrate Your Communication Prowess
As communication is key in this role,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. You might even want to role-play some common sales scenarios with a friend to get comfortable with your pitch and responses.
